Output 642ac3cdb0ff86ddac6966df533385af5a651ed7128a868d58b4b8a3101e32d4:0

value
160951831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a72bddd10b64b3c6f35513453ed7f05a7d773ed OP_EQUAL
address
346rwvPNdkbSCswNiQ1M4aZgwHbHSALZzE
transaction
642ac3cdb0ff86ddac6966df533385af5a651ed7128a868d58b4b8a3101e32d4
spent
true